Ассоциация ЭБНИТ    ИРБИС-корпорация    Вики-Ирбис    Online/CHM справка Ирбис    FTP-сервер
Электронные архивы :  ИРБИС Irbis
Cистема структурированного хранения электронных документов, обеспечивающая надежность хранения, конфиденциальность и разграничение прав доступа, отслеживание истории использования документа, быстрый и удобный поиск. Источник: Wikipedia 
Страницы: <<1234567891011...Последняя>>
Страница: 3 из 57
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 05, June, 2012 20:52

OMEN
Статья по изменению внешнего вида интерфесов DSpace на англ. языке
Изменение внешнего вида DSpace

Re: DSpace (установка, настройка)
Пользователь: IdeaFix (IP-адрес скрыт)
Дата: 06, June, 2012 22:44

Коллеги, есть вопрос:

Допустим, хочу я иметь русские символы в параметре dspace.name... ну. сделать его равным фразе "Электронный архив", например.

Открываю конфиг, пишу

dspace.name = &#1069;&#1083;&#1077;&#1082;&#1090;&#1088;&#1086;&#1085;&#1085;&#1099;&#1081; &#1072;&#1088;&#1093;&#1080;&#1074;

и всё вроде хорошо, но появляется проблема с RSS. В основной ленте обновлений всего архива в заголовке имею не "электронный архив", а строку "&#1069;&#1083;&#1077;&#1082;&#1090;&#1088;&#1086;&#1085;&#1085;&#1099;&#1081; &#1072;&#1088;&#1093;&#1080;&#1074;"

Куда копать? Хачить ленту не хотелось бы... ведь эта проблема еще и с почтовыми уведомлениями наверняка вылезет...

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 07, June, 2012 00:25

Проблема может быть в том, что в файле конфигурации dspace.cfg слова на кириллице нужно указывать примерно в таком виде:
\u0415\u043b\u0435\u043a\u0442\u0440\u043e\u043d\u043d\u0438\u0439 \u0430\u0440\u0445\u0456\u0432  \u041f\u043e\u043b\u0442\u0430\u0432\u0441\u044c\u043a\u043e\u0433\u043e \u0443\u043d\u0456\u0432\u0435\u0440\u0441\u0438\u0442\u0435\u0442\u0443 \u0435\u043a\u043e\u043d\u043e\u043c\u0456\u043a\u0438 \u0456 \u0442\u043e\u0440\u0433\u0456\u0432\u043b\u0456
В результате получим
Електронний архів  Полтавського університету економіки і торгівлі
Т. е. использовать расширенные utf-коды.



Редактировано 1 раз. Последний раз 07.06.2012 00:37 пользователем woodyfon.

Re: DSpace (установка, настройка)
Пользователь: IdeaFix (IP-адрес скрыт)
Дата: 07, June, 2012 10:14

К сожалению, когда я использую кодирование, которое привык называть "JavaScript escapes", то получаю в веб интерфейсе не кирилические буквы - а именно строку кодов :(

Юникодные коды хоть дек хоть хекс в веб интерфейсе отображаются верно, а вот в RSS ленте нет. Сегодня ночью буду настраивать почтовые уведомления, если и в них будет косяк - хоть отказывайся от русских буков :(

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 07, June, 2012 10:51

Хороший ресурс по настройке DSpace. На англ. яз.
Кириллица не будет работать в DSpace пока кота не настроить:
URIEncoding=“UTF-8”
При этом по прежнему требуется кириллические слова вводить через utf-коды.
Вообще во все сервлетах нужно писать коды русских букв, а не сами слова.

Re: DSpace (установка, настройка)
Пользователь: IdeaFix (IP-адрес скрыт)
Дата: 08, June, 2012 20:51

Это в коте уже настроено, русский поиск, руский алфавит для быстрого перехода по первым буквам, русские слова в интерфейсе, копирацты и пр - это всё работает, не работает русский в RSS, причём только в названии канала корневого, в остальном всё хорошо. На выходных всётаки добирусь до ответа на вопрос, кто это гадит, кот или диспейс...

Re: DSpace (установка, настройка)
Пользователь: IdeaFix (IP-адрес скрыт)
Дата: 09, June, 2012 07:40

Вот пример:

[194.226.243.242]
[194.226.243.242]

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 09, June, 2012 10:24

Знаете, я до сих пор не понял в чем проблема. Не могли бы еще раз объяснить. Аж самому интересно стало.

Re: DSpace (установка, настройка)
Пользователь: IdeaFix (IP-адрес скрыт)
Дата: 09, June, 2012 11:52

[ideafix.name]

Вот картинка. Несоответствия обведены красным.

Название организации и копирайт вбиты соответственно в dspace.cfg и в footer интерфейса jspui десятичными юникод кодами. В интерфейсе JSPUI проблем нет, в ленте RSS есть.

Если заменить десятичные коды шестнадцатеричными - результат тот же самиый, если использовать яваскрипт эскейпы - не работает ни там ни там.

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 09, June, 2012 12:41

У меня такое ощущение, что браузер не может правильно определить кодировку. Открываю в Opera - вообще проблем нету - кодировка Кириллица (Автоопределение). Также смущает вида utf-кодов. Ну не могут они быть такого вида:
&#1069;&#1083;&#1077;&#1082;&#1090;&#1088;&#1086;&#1085;&#1085;&#1099;&#1081; &#1072;&#1088;&#1093;&#1080;&#1074;
Только так:
\u0438
Попробуйте поменять кодировку в браузере вручную (ASCII, UTF-8 и так дальше).
Вот если не поменяются &#1069; и др., то проблема не в кодировке браузера.
Попробуйте сайт открыть в других браузерах.
Электронный архив УГЛТУ
dspace.name = \u042D\u043B\u0435\u043A\u0442\u0440\u043E\u043D\u043D\u044B\u0439 \u0430\u0440\u0445\u0438\u0432 \u0423\u0413\u041B\u0422\u0423
Пропишите так в dspace.cfg

Re: DSpace (установка, настройка)
Пользователь: IdeaFix (IP-адрес скрыт)
Дата: 09, June, 2012 14:35

Блин, заработало. Сейчас смотрел свои старые правки - с эскейп кодами у меня точно такой же был конфиг буква в букву - диспейс вываливал строку кодов на главной! Чудеса...

Re: DSpace (установка, настройка)
Пользователь: shadeofpast (IP-адрес скрыт)
Дата: 20, June, 2012 08:17

Можно ли используя OAI собирать коллекции с электронных каталогов расположенных на web ИРБИС?
Почему с большинства русских серверов на DSpace (за исключением одного) получается собирать только в формате простого Дублинского ядра?
Спасибо.



Редактировано 2 раз. Последний раз 20.06.2012 08:32 пользователем shadeofpast.

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 20, June, 2012 10:30

Цитата:
Можно ли используя OAI собирать коллекции с электронных каталогов расположенных на web ИРБИС?
Нет.
Цитата:
Почему с большинства русских серверов на DSpace (за исключением одного) получается собирать только в формате простого Дублинского ядра?
Потому что форматом описания библиографических данных по умолчанию есть Dublin Core. И не каждое учреждение имеет специалиста, знающего как это изменить.

Re: DSpace (установка, настройка)
Пользователь: shadeofpast (IP-адрес скрыт)
Дата: 21, June, 2012 03:02

А какие-нибудь аналоги этого протокола поддерживает web ИРБИС? Он вроде поддерживает z39.50, но его нету в DSpace. Насколько я понял - там только OAI-PMH.
Я имел в виду, что не получается получить метаданные в расширенном Дублинском ядре. А в простом их описание не достаточно чтобы отделить одно поле от другого.
Какие существуют решения по интеграции DSpace(или Eprints) и ИРБИС?
Можно ли индексировать разные поля метаданных у разных коллекций? Или лучше при сборе преобразовывать все к одному?



Редактировано 3 раз. Последний раз 21.06.2012 06:30 пользователем shadeofpast.

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 21, June, 2012 12:40

OAI-PMH - это протокол передачи данных. WI его не поддерживает. Единственным пока доступным решением интеграции WI в DSpace есть экспорт записей в Dublin Core с последующим импортом. перечень полей можно самостоятельно расширить.
Цитата:
Можно ли индексировать разные поля метаданных у разных коллекций? Или лучше при сборе преобразовывать все к одному?
Отсюда поподробнее. Имеем отдельно коллекции в WI и DSpace. И тот и другой позволяет создавать свои собственные словари.

Re: DSpace (установка, настройка)
Пользователь: shadeofpast (IP-адрес скрыт)
Дата: 22, June, 2012 02:22

woodyfon написал(а):
-------------------------------------------------------
> Единственным пока доступным решением
> интеграции WI в DSpace есть экспорт записей в
> Dublin Core с последующим импортом.

А можно ссылку на информацию о том как и чем экспортировать из WI.

> Отсюда поподробнее. Имеем отдельно коллекции в WI
> и DSpace. И тот и другой позволяет создавать свои
> собственные словари.

Нет. Имеем в DSpace 3 коллекции. 1-ая - создавали сами. 2-ая -импортировали через OAI метаданные в простом ДЯ. 3-я - в расширенном ДЯ.
Соответственно, например поле аннотация в каждой коллекции хранится в разных тегах. И тут либо индексировать каждую коллекцию отдельно, либо менять метаданные под 1 форму. Я склоняюсь ко второму, ибо при импорте в простом ДЯ разные метаданные могут храниться в одинаковых тегах (dc.identifier и dc.identifier.uri, dc.identifier.citation, dc.identifier.ispartofseries), а также авторы используют разные теги для хранения одних и тех же метаданных(dc.creator и dc.contributor).

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 22, June, 2012 11:40

Рекомендую для начала ознакомиться с форматом Dublin Core. Определить перечень необходимых полей. Привести все записи к одному виду. В дальнейшем не будет проблемы с индексированием.

Re: DSpace (установка, настройка)
Пользователь: Lavrinovich (IP-адрес скрыт)
Дата: 23, June, 2012 15:24

shadeofpast написал(а):
-------------------------------------------------------
> А какие-нибудь аналоги этого протокола
> поддерживает web ИРБИС? Он вроде поддерживает
> z39.50, но его нету в DSpace. Насколько я понял -
> там только OAI-PMH.
> Я имел в виду, что не получается получить
> метаданные в расширенном Дублинском ядре. А в
> простом их описание не достаточно чтобы отделить
> одно поле от другого.
> Какие существуют решения по интеграции DSpace(или
> Eprints) и ИРБИС?
Уточните, пожалуйста, какую интеграцию вы имеете в виду и с чем именно? Только при поиске или не только?
Вряд ли с И64 ПБД - это было бы бессмысленно, ведь он отчасти конкурент. Значит, так сказать, с "простым" ИРБИСом, "библиографическим"? Единственное, что приходит в голову - упомянутое выше Dublin Core [irbis.gpntb.ru]
Поиск одновременно в ЭК и ПБД - о нем здесь
[irbis.gpntb.ru]
Но вот одновременно в ЭК и ЭБС? Вообще ведь пока не вполне ясно, что значит "ЭБС"...

irbis_arbat@mail.ru



Редактировано 3 раз. Последний раз 25.06.2012 09:05 пользователем Lavrinovich.

Re: DSpace (установка, настройка)
Пользователь: shadeofpast (IP-адрес скрыт)
Дата: 25, June, 2012 02:04

Всем спасибо. Буду разбираться.

Re: DSpace (установка, настройка)
Пользователь: Lavrinovich (IP-адрес скрыт)
Дата: 25, June, 2012 09:08

И еще очень сомневаюсь, что существуют специалисты одновременно по DSpace (или Eprints) и ИРБИС. А задачу их интеграции тем более до сих пор никто не ставил, видимо.
Есть интеграция с бухгалтерской системой ПАРУС, но это ГПНТБ сделала для себя, а потом включила в ИРБИС для демонстрации его возможностей [irbis.gpntb.ru]
Или как пример для подражания (творчества продвинутых пользователей)?
И опять-таки нужно уточнить: интеграция - это выгрузка/загрузка или нечто гораздо большее? Например [irbis.gpntb.ru]

irbis_arbat@mail.ru



Редактировано 5 раз. Последний раз 27.06.2012 10:51 пользователем Lavrinovich.

Re: DSpace (установка, настройка)
Пользователь: Lavrinovich (IP-адрес скрыт)
Дата: 27, June, 2012 09:27

Вот сообщение и небольшая дискуссия об интеграции ЭБС, в том числе отечественных, с ЭБ, c АИС вуза, включая выгрузку в MARC21 и RUSMARC [www.aselibrary.ru]
И даже ответы на ваши вопросы. В частности. М.Е.Шварцман сообщает,
что ведутся работы в направлении поддержки OAI-PMH в Web_ИРБИС. Спрашивать,конечно, вам удобнее там. И пожалуйста, формулируйте попонятнее!

irbis_arbat@mail.ru



Редактировано 3 раз. Последний раз 28.06.2012 16:35 пользователем Lavrinovich.

Re: DSpace (установка, настройка)
Пользователь: IdeaFix (IP-адрес скрыт)
Дата: 17, July, 2012 15:07

Коллеги, а как массово обновить поле "URI (Унифицированный идентификатор ресурса):" после обновления handle префикса и/или смены доменного имени в случае локального хэндла?

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 05, August, 2012 22:58

Для будущих записей в dspace.cfg. Для существующих править sql-базу.

Re: DSpace (установка, настройка)
Пользователь: IdeaFix (IP-адрес скрыт)
Дата: 17, August, 2012 04:25

> Для существующих править sql-базу.

А можно об этм поподробнее?

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 17, August, 2012 23:42

Чтобы исправить данные в sql-базе, необходимо сделать запрос. Для этого надо знать язык запросов. На словах, обратиться к нужной таблице и изменить данные. Каая именно таблица за это отвечает посмотрите в pgAdmin.

Re: DSpace (установка, настройка)
Пользователь: IdeaFix (IP-адрес скрыт)
Дата: 20, August, 2012 04:40

Всё сломаю....мне проще (безопаснее для сервиса) скрипт для изменения этого поля через веб написать.

Re: DSpace (установка, настройка)
Пользователь: kuzina13 (IP-адрес скрыт)
Дата: 29, August, 2012 14:50

Здравствуйте! Моя организация только начинает разбираться с DSpace, да и впринципе установили мы его "методом тыка". Никто ничего нам не показывал и ни чему не учил.
Такая проблема: при нажатии внизу страницы на "Обратная связь" переходим на форму, на которой у нас подписано: Форма для зобратной связи. Как убрать букву "з"?

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 30, August, 2012 09:53

Какая версия DSpace? Правка формы сводится к правке локализационных файлов. Приведите ссылку на сайт.

Re: DSpace (установка, настройка)
Пользователь: pauleta (IP-адрес скрыт)
Дата: 03, September, 2012 13:07

Уважаемые эксперты, ответьте, пожалуйста, как можно сделать доступной для пользователей статистику репозитария?



Редактировано 1 раз. Последний раз 03.09.2012 13:09 пользователем pauleta.

Re: DSpace (установка, настройка)
Пользователь: woodyfon (IP-адрес скрыт)
Дата: 03, September, 2012 14:19

В файле dspace.cfg
report.public = true

Страницы: <<1234567891011...Последняя>>
Страница: 3 из 57


Извините, только зарегистрированные пользователи могут писать в этом форуме.
This forum powered by Phorum.